On October 11, 2003, Alyson Hannigan married Alexis Denisof throughout a three-day celebration at Two Bunch Palms resort outside Palm Springs. The bride wore a custom-made ivory satin robe with Chantilly lace and bead overlay by Badgley Mischka. Of her dress, Hannigan simply stated, "It was perfection." Over 2 billion people watched the royal marriage ceremony on April 29, 2011, and Kate Middleton didn't disappoint. For her walk down the aisle, the new Duchess of Cambridge wore a robe designed by Sarah Burton of Alexander McQueen.

Many Western ceremonial clothes are derived from Christian ritual costumes. Modesty has lengthy been a virtue for women, according to Christianity. In response to this trend, brides often wore veils, and likewise lengthy white gloves with sleeveless or strapless attire. Long gloves allowed ladies to hide the pores and skin on their arms if that they had a no sleeve on their top which enabled them to cowl up and preserve th
modesty.

The indigenous peoples of the Americas have varying traditions associated to weddings and thus wedding ceremony attire. A Hopi bride traditionally had her clothes woven by the groom and any males within the village who wished
part.
